Output bbdb259aa160c04c4fa7a0bdeb973c5686a99a619facbc34cbb6f87771003137:1

value
270654
script pubkey
OP_0 OP_PUSHBYTES_20 8a68aac7c60a12e197ff2c12a0cbf8c45593457c
address
bc1q3f52437xpgfwr9ll9sf2pjlcc32ex3tuhar48h
transaction
bbdb259aa160c04c4fa7a0bdeb973c5686a99a619facbc34cbb6f87771003137
confirmations
170690
spent
true